零基础开始转行做软件测试,我该从哪方面入手学?

如题所述

做任何一行,打好基础最重要。尤其在软件测试的面试中,大多都还是问些理论问题的。那么,测试基础有哪些内容?测试的定义、测试的分类、测试的方法、测试的生命周期。测试计划、测试方案、测试策略、测试用例的编写。BUG的定义、BUG的分类、BUG的六要素、BUG的生命周期。测试和开发流程的关系、瀑布流、V字形、W字型(双V)、螺旋型、敏捷等等。戴明环、5W2H等分析管理的方法质量管理体系CMMI(了解)。掌握了基础知识和工具之后,已经能够做基础的软件测试工作,但想要能够胜任更多的工作岗位,代码多少还是要学习一些的。
温馨提示:内容为网友见解,仅供参考
第1个回答  2019-04-04
我们需要想象我们掌握的知识点是一个一个积木,而现在你先去看哪些积木你还没有,你先去获得。就比如java都不怎么会,然后就说自己要去做自动化,android都不了解就说要做自动化。没有太大必要。积木一个一个去搭,然后方向自然而然的就有了。目前学习移动无线的应用测试没有什么一定的路,每个人所在公司不同,所处业务不同,不要去问别人,最重要的是自己静下心来,记住,是静下心来问自己,自己真的不懂,如果自己是什么都不懂,那么就踏踏实实的从语言的学习,android本身的文档,工具等一个一个去学,不要浮躁。只要踏实了,不会没有方向,方向永远在你的心中。
第2个回答  2019-04-04
如果想快速上手,可以直接去网易云课堂、慕课网等搜索测试课程,前者的《测试工程师》微专业是网易自己出品的,课程编排成体系化,授课老师是一线测试工程师,强调实践能力,而且会定期考核节课,有预算、且缺乏自制力的同学可以考虑。后者上的课程都是免费的,但比较零散,适合想要长线作战的同学入手。
第3个回答  2019-04-04
测试既是产品的第一个体验者(最早从开发手中接过成型的产品),也是产品质量的最后一道防线守卫者(做各种测试,保证用户拿到的最终成品可用、易用)。因为测试的工作特性,他需要从用户的角度出发体验产品,这也决定了测试与开发、策划、设计等岗位交流、沟通的时间也会成为工作的一部分,甚至承担起整个产品的协调工作。这样看来,把测试称为QA(质量保证人员)也就一点不奇怪了。
第4个回答  2019-04-04
测试界领军人物James Bach写的《软件测试经验与教训》,从测试的角色入手,全方位剖析测试的方法技巧、职业发展,文中有很多话都被奉为测试界的经典箴言,不愧是一路被坑之后撰写而成的血泪史,不仅是测试入门的读物,更适合搭配实际工作经验一起食用,字字珠玑,常看常新。

软件测试难不难学?该怎么学习?
1. **测试理论基础**:无论是否有计算机基础,学习测试理论都是首要任务。涉及常见软件开发流程、敏捷开发知识、测试定义、分类、流程、用例编写、bug管理与生命周期,以及web和app测试点。2. **数据库**:掌握数据库基础,了解SQL增删改查及表操作语句,熟悉数据库工具(如Navicat)。3. **Linux**:...

软件测试怎么学?
2.网络和数据库基础知识。现在的软件基本都离不开网络和数据库应用。所以这两块的基础知识也是必须掌握的。不需要太深,网络知道互联网发展,现代网络架构,IP分配知识,网络七层协议等,数据库要会基本的增删改查语句操作。这个在网上找一些资料和练习题做一做就可以了。3.开发语言基础。这个很重要。测...

零基础如何自学软件测试
1、首先是对于行业的认知 目前很多人转IT,但是IT也有很多的岗位,你需要对岗位的工作内容,工作环境,薪资,发展,入职要求等做好相应的了解。2、其次给自己规划适合的路线 前者提到IT岗位很多,那么你自己想要从事什么岗位,能从事什么岗位,适合什么岗位,以后你想要得到什么,后续的发展路线是怎么样做好...

0基础怎么学软件测试?
首先学习软件测试是个不错的选择,总体上来说入门难度并不算高,即使计算机基础知识比较薄弱的人,只要通过一个系统的学习过程,也是能够满足软件测试岗位的基本要求的。不过入门软件测试的难度并不算高,但是需要学习的内容却比较多,也比较杂。只是可能相对有基础的人来说,他们可以选择自学,而没有基础...

想转行软件测试怎么学习
有开发的地方就有测试。在这些测试方向中,还会分行业,比如金融测试、安全测试等等。如果你有相关的行业知识那就更好了,这样你的薪资会比一般的测试工程师更高。由此可见,软件测试并不难,不管你之前的基础如何,只要你在好的培训机构,按部就班地认真学习,找到一份满意的工作是完全能实现的。

软件测试需要学习些什么技能?
4、掌握数据库 掌握数据库非常重要,这个世界由许许多多数据组成,软件测试,就是满足客户的需求,但必须数据正确,其实软件工程师需要对数据流向的了解,才能更加深入地了解业务,这也是一项基本技能之一。5、App测试 App测试,从兴起到目前市场的成熟,APP可以说成为市场上的主流产品。若你不会APP的测试...

零基础怎么学习软件测试
零基础学习软件测试无非有两种方式:自学和培训。关于自学,无需多言,如果你自律性强,具备学习能力、有专研问题的好奇心、以及解决问题的能力,那么自学是完全ok的。蜗牛学院这里也给大家整理了一份软件测试的学习路线,希望可以帮助大家少走弯路。如果你选择培训,那么就分线上课程培训以及线下面授培训。...

如果女生转行去做软件测试,需要去培训一下哪儿方面? 坐标深圳
1、开始自学的时候找一本书来入门,这个阶段主要是学习理论知识;2、有基础知识之后找一个软件来自己操作、从开始写测试计划、测试用例,到自己完成测试、并输出测试报告(这个阶段必须自己操作,如果有问题可以去软件测试类论坛提问)。3、在执行第二个步骤的时候经常多去软件测试类论坛看看那些问题帖子,...

软件测试难不难,是自学还是报班学习啊?
每个人有适合自己的学习方式,因人而异,自学和培训各有各的优劣势。首要考虑你想要学习软件测试的目的是什么。只是作为一个兴趣爱好,还是想进入IT行业,做一个软件测试工程师。一. 自学:①首先考虑下自己的学习理解能力如何?自律性高吗?优势是金钱成本较低,能够按照自己设定的学习计划进行学习,时间...

学计算机专业的女生,就业好难啊,想自学软件测试
3:按照测试计划和测试文档进行测试,并报告测试缺陷。这个地方要求你会一两个缺陷管理系统,如TestDirector, Bugzillar等。4:对开发改正缺陷以后的版本进行回归测试,确认缺陷是否已经改正,是否出现新的缺陷。5:最后你要写出测试总结报告,有的公司可能要求你对软件打分以决定是否能够通过测试。打分标准应该...

相似回答